Title |
Ensiling of crops for biogas production: effects on methane yield and total solids determination
|
---|---|
Published in |
Biotechnology for Biofuels and Bioproducts, October 2011
|
DOI | 10.1186/1754-6834-4-44 |
Pubmed ID | |
Authors |
Emma Kreuger, Ivo Achu Nges, Lovisa Björnsson |
Abstract |
Ensiling is a common method of preserving energy crops for anaerobic digestion, and many scientific studies report that ensiling increases the methane yield. In this study, the ensiling process and the methane yields before and after ensiling were studied for four crop materials. |
